Rigney opens international conference

David A. Rigney, S.M. ’62 (applied physics), presented the conference-opening invited talk at the 21st International Conference on the Wear of Materials (WOM). Rigney’s talk addressed “Modeling and the Real World.”

The presentation was part of a symposium in honor of Ken Ludema, the principal organizer of the first WOM conference, held 40 years ago. Rigney’s first paper on tribology was presented at that initial conference.

Rigney, who also holds a bachelor’s degree in chemistry and physics from Harvard University and a Ph.D. in materials science and engineering from Cornell University, is Professor Emeritus of Materials Science and Engineering at The Ohio State University.
